VMware作为虚拟化技术的领导者,为用户提供了强大且灵活的虚拟机管理方案
然而,随着应用的增长和数据量的增加,虚拟机常常面临存储空间不足的问题
本文将详细介绍如何有效地增加VMware虚拟空间,以确保虚拟机的稳定运行和高效性能
一、VMware虚拟空间增加的重要性 虚拟机通过模拟硬件环境,允许在同一物理机上运行多个操作系统
这种技术不仅提高了硬件资源的利用率,还带来了极大的灵活性和便捷性
然而,随着应用的安装、数据的累积和日志的增长,虚拟机的存储空间往往会逐渐耗尽
当存储空间不足时,虚拟机可能会出现性能下降、应用崩溃甚至无法启动等问题
因此,适时增加VMware虚拟空间至关重要
二、增加VMware虚拟空间的方法 增加VMware虚拟空间的方法主要包括增加虚拟磁盘大小、添加新虚拟硬盘以及调整操作系统分区大小
以下将详细介绍这些方法及其操作步骤
1. 增加虚拟磁盘大小 增加虚拟磁盘大小是最常见且直接的方法
通过VMware Workstation或VMware vSphere Client,可以轻松调整虚拟磁盘的容量
步骤一:关闭虚拟机 首先,确保虚拟机处于关机状态
这是因为在磁盘调整过程中,如果虚拟机正在运行,可能会导致数据损坏或系统崩溃
步骤二:打开VMware设置 打开VMware Workstation或VMware vSphere Client,找到需要扩容的虚拟机
右键点击虚拟机,选择“设置”或“Edit Settings”
步骤三:调整磁盘大小 在设置窗口中,找到并选择“硬盘”或“Hard Disk”选项
在硬盘设置中,找到“Provisioned Size”或“容量”选项,调整磁盘大小到所需的容量
例如,将磁盘空间从20GB扩展到50GB
步骤四:保存更改 点击“确定”或“OK”保存更改
此时,VMware将开始调整虚拟磁盘的大小
这个过程可能需要一些时间,具体取决于磁盘的大小和虚拟机的性能
步骤五:操作系统中调整分区大小 调整虚拟磁盘大小后,还需要在虚拟机的操作系统中调整分区大小以利用新增加的磁盘空间
- Windows操作系统:使用内置的磁盘管理工具进行分区调整
右键点击“计算机”或“此电脑”,选择“管理”,在“计算机管理”窗口中,选择“磁盘管理”
找到需要扩展的分区,右键点击,选择“扩展卷”,然后根据向导完成分区扩展操作
- Linux操作系统:使用fdisk、parted或gparted等工具进行分区调整
例如,在Ubuntu中,可以使用以下命令安装gparted:`sudo apt-get install gparted -y`
然后启动gparted进行分区调整
需要注意的是,在Linux中调整分区大小可能需要修改挂载文件夹的读写权限或取消挂载状态
2. 添加新虚拟硬盘 除了增加现有虚拟磁盘的大小外,还可以添加新的虚拟硬盘来扩展存储空间
步骤一:打开VMware设置 同样地,在VMware Workstation或VMware vSphere Client中,找到需要扩容的虚拟机
右键点击虚拟机,选择“设置”或“Edit Settings”
步骤二:添加新硬盘 在设置窗口中,点击“添加”或“Add”按钮
选择“硬盘”或“Hard Disk”,然后根据向导创建新的虚拟硬盘
设置好新硬盘的大小和类型后(如SCSI或SATA),点击“确定”或“OK”保存更改
步骤三:操作系统中配置新硬盘 添加新硬盘后,需要在虚拟机的操作系统中进行配置
- Windows操作系统:使用磁盘管理工具初始化并格式化新硬盘
在“磁盘管理”中,找到新添加的硬盘,右键点击,选择“初始化磁盘”并进行格式化
- Linux操作系统:使用命令行工具fdisk或parted进行分区,并使用mkfs命令格式化新硬盘
例如,可以使用以下命令进行分区和格式化:`sudo fdisk /dev/sdb`(假设新硬盘为/dev/sdb),然后根据提示进行分区操作,并使用`mkfs.ext4 /dev/sdb1`进行格式化
3. 使用第三方工具进行扩容 除了上述方法外,还可以使用第三方工具进行虚拟机扩容
这些工具通常具有更强大的功能和更友好的界面
- Acronis Disk Director:这是一款功能强大的磁盘管理工具,支持虚拟机磁盘扩容操作
下载并安装Acronis Disk Director后,启动虚拟机并运行该工具
选择需要扩展的分区,然后使用工具提供的向导进行磁盘扩容操作
- GParted:这是一款开源的分区管理工具,支持Linux和Windows操作系统
可以下载并创建GParted Live CD或USB,然后将虚拟机设置为从光驱或USB启动
启动虚拟机并加载GParted Live CD或USB后,使用GParted工具进行分区扩容操作
三、扩容后的虚拟机性能优化 在扩容虚拟机后,还需要进行一些性能优化以确保其稳定运行
1. 定期备份虚拟机数据 定期备份虚拟机数据是保障数据安全的重要措施
可以使用VMware自带的快照功能或第三方备份工具进行备份
快照功能可以记录虚拟机在某个时间点的状态,以便在需要时恢复到该状态
而第三方备份工具则提供了更丰富的备份选项和更强大的恢复能力
2. 合理分配资源 合理分配虚拟机的CPU、内存和磁盘资源可以避免资源过度使用导致性能下降
可以在VMware中调整虚拟机的资源分配策略,如增加内存、升级CPU或升级到更高速的磁盘
需要注意的是,在调整资源分配时,要确保物理机的资源能够满足虚拟机的需求
3. 监控虚拟机性能 使用VMware提供的性能监控工具或第三方监控软件可以实时监控虚拟机的性能指标,如CPU使用率、内存占用率、磁盘I/O等
通过监控这些指标,可以及时发现并解决性能瓶颈问题
例如,如果发现某个虚拟机的CPU使用率过高,可以考虑增加其CPU数量或提高其优先级
4. 优化操作系统设置 在虚拟机中运行的操作系统也需要进行优化设置以提高性能
例如,在Windows中可以禁用不必要的视觉效果和服务;在Linux中可以调整内核参数以优化网络性能和磁盘I/O性能
此外,还可以定期对虚拟机磁盘进行碎片整理以保持其性能
四、结论 增加VMware虚拟空间是确保虚拟机稳定运行和高效性能的重要措施
通过增加虚拟磁盘大小、添加新虚拟硬盘或使用第三方工具进行扩容等方法,可以有效地扩展虚拟机的存储空间
同时,还需要进行性能优化以确保虚拟机在扩容后能够稳定运行
这些优化措施包括定期备份数据、合理分配资源、监控虚拟机性能以及优化操作系统设置等
通过综合运用这些方法和技术手段,可以确保VMware虚拟机在面对不断增长的数据存储需求时始终保持高效稳定的运行状态